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ions with Pinco
Cas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players. Pinco recognizes these offers as valuable opportunities to increase your bankroll and extend your playtime. However, it’s important to carefully read the terms and conditions associated with each bonus. Wagering requirements, game restrictions, and maximum bet limits can significantly impact the overall value of a bonus. A pinco player strategically utilizes bonuses that offer the most favorable terms, maximizing their potential return and minimizing risk. It’s also about understanding the value and looking beyond the headline amount.
- Wagering Requirements: Understand how many times you need to bet the bonus amount before withdrawing winnings.
- Game Restrictions: Identify which games contribute to the wagering requirements, and their respective contribution percentages.
- Maximum Bet Limits: Be aware of any limitations on the maximum bet size when playing with bonus funds.
- Time Limits: Bonuses often have expiration dates, so use them efficiently.

Understanding Variance and Its Impact
Variance, also known as volatility, is a fundamental concept in casino gaming. It refers to the degree to which your results will fluctuate over time. High-variance games offer the potential for large payouts but come with increased risk, while low-variance games offer smaller, more frequent wins. Understanding the variance of a game is crucial for managing expectations and adjusting your betting strategy. Pinco encourages players to select games whose variance aligns with their risk tolerance and bankroll size. For instance, a conservative player with a limited bankroll might prefer low-variance games, while a more aggressive player might be willing to accept the increased risk of high-variance games. This understanding is key to not chasing losses.
